Transaction 04006f63ececdcfc70c2e868d53fa73c94de8548b66d8fdcd49a1b827838a879
1 Input
2 Outputs
- 04006f63ececdcfc70c2e868d53fa73c94de8548b66d8fdcd49a1b827838a879:0
- 04006f63ececdcfc70c2e868d53fa73c94de8548b66d8fdcd49a1b827838a879:1
value 74117
address 18S45Eorgh8UBcUuny9uM8XoR1YNW2RCJu
value 7337607
address 3MBbKTbcN72RNDMwoBtaP9QtKWcmiVfM3X